St. Andrews Lutheran Church hosts Yard Sale on March 4

Religious Wednesday, February 15, 2017

St. Andrews Lutheran Church will have a yard sale on Saturday, March 4 from 7 a.m. to 2 p.m. The church, located at 575 W. 68 Street, is raising funds to provide continuing support for the church’s food bank and other ministry activities.

Sydney Medina of Miami Lakes has qualified for the Fall 2016 Dean’s List at Seton Hall University in South Orange, New Jersey.Dean’s List students must have at least a 3.4 grade point average and no grade lower than a C. Seton Hall is one of the nation’s leading Catholic universities.
